生长分化因子5基因真核表达质粒pcDNA3.1(+)/hGDF5的构建、鉴定及其活性检测

         

摘要

Objective To construct and identify eukaryotic expression plasmid pcDNA3.1(+)/hGDF5 con-taining growth/differentiation factor 5 gene.The activity of pcDNA3.1 (+)/hGDF5 was detected.Met-hods According to the sequence of GDF5 in Genbank,the primers were designed and synthesized.The product was cloned with pcDNA3.1(+)vector after amplification with polymerase chain reaction (PCR). The eukaryotic expression plasmid pcDNA3.1(+)/hGDF5 was identified by double restrictive edonuclease and PCR.The eukaryotic expression plasmids were transferred into MC615 and 293 cells.The expression of GDP5 mRAN and protein were detected by PCR,Western blotting and immunofluorescence.Results The eukaryotic expression plasmid pcDNA3.1(+)/hGDF5 was successfully constructed and identified by double restrictive edonuclease digestion and PCR.The expression of GDF5 mRAN and protein could be de-tected in MC615 and 293 cells by PCR,Western blotting and immunofluorescence.Conclusion The eu-karyotic expression plasmid pcDNA3.1 (+)/hGDF5 was successfully established, which lays the foundation for the function research of GDP5 .%目的:构建生长分化因子5(growth/differentiation factor 5,GDF5)基因的真核表达质粒 pcDNA3.1(+)/hGDF5,并对其进行鉴定和活性检测。方法根据 Genbank中人 GDF5序列设计并合成引物,以 pCA350-hGDF5质粒为模板进行聚合酶链式反应(polymerase chain reaction,PCR)扩增获得 GDF5基因,并与 pcDNA3.1(+)质粒连接构建真核表达质粒 pcDNA3.1(+)/hGDF5。pcDNA3.1(+)/hGDF5经限制性内切酶消化、PCR扩增进行鉴定。将 pcDNA3.1(+)/hGDF5分别转染 MC615细胞及293细胞,利用 PCR、Western blotting及免疫荧光法检测 GDF5 mRNA及蛋白的表达。结果真核表达质粒 pcDNA3.1(+)/hGDF5经限制性内切酶酶切、PCR扩增表明构建成功,PCR、Western blotting及免疫荧光实验结果显示真核表达质粒 pcDNA3.1(+)/hGDF5能在MC615细胞及293细胞中稳定表达。结论成功构建了真核表达质粒 pcDNA3.1(+)/hGDF5,为进一步研究GDF5的功能奠定了基础。
